sad to hear Jona making the official announcement that he is not continuing with InAisce. one of the most talented new designers out there but carving a market in this niche is difficult, and with the cost associated with the level of quality of the fabrics and construction for relatively small production runs it isn't hard to understand why the label couldn't continue in its current capacity.
